Smarter Traffic Signals and Intersection Management
One of the most visible enhancements AI has actually given urban transport remains in the way traffic signal operate. Conventional signal systems work on timers or easy sensing units. Yet AI can assess real-time footage, detect vehicle quantity, and adjust light cycles on the fly. This change decreases unnecessary idling, boosts fuel performance, and-- maybe most significantly-- shortens commute times.
Some cities have begun to couple AI-powered cameras with traffic signal to find not just lorries, however pedestrians and bicyclists also. This allows signals to change for vulnerable roadway customers, enhancing safety without reducing overall web traffic flow.
Public Transit Gets a High-Tech Upgrade
Buses and trains are important lifelines in a lot of cities. Yet hold-ups, route ineffectiveness, and upkeep issues typically annoy riders. That's starting to alter with the help of AI.
Transportation companies are currently making use of anticipating analytics to take care of fleets much better. If a bus is running behind schedule, AI can advise route changes, alternate pickup points, or even reassign vehicles in real-time. Maintenance is additionally more proactive; AI identifies very early indication prior to parts stop working, which keeps vehicles on the road and riders on schedule.
When public transportation is consistent and dependable, more individuals use it. And when more individuals utilize public transit, cities become greener, much less busy, and much easier to navigate.
Redefining Parking with Smart Systems
Locating a parking place in a city can be one of the most aggravating part of driving. It's time-consuming, demanding, and commonly inefficient. Yet AI is now changing the method cities deal with parking monitoring.
Cams and sensing units set up in car park and garages track offered rooms and send updates to central systems. Drivers can then be assisted to open areas via navigating applications or in-car systems, minimizing the time they invest circling the block. Subsequently, this cuts exhausts and makes city roads much less crowded.
Some AI systems are even efficient in vibrant rates, adjusting car park fees based on need in real time. This dissuades overuse in congested areas and urges turnover, giving everybody a fairer chance at locating a room.

The Rise of Autonomous Vehicles and Ridesharing Intelligence
While self-driving vehicles may not yet control the roadways, they're certainly affecting the instructions of urban transport. AI is the foundation of autonomous automobile modern technology, dealing with whatever from navigation to obstacle discovery and feedback time.
But even before complete autonomy takes hold, AI is currently transforming ridesharing solutions. Algorithms assist set guests more effectively, minimize wait times, and advise critical locations for drivers to wait between prices. Over time, these insights will help in reducing traffic jam and enhance vehicle occupancy rates throughout cities.
There's additionally been a rise in AI-enhanced mini flexibility alternatives like mobility scooters and bike shares. These services are managed by AI systems that track use patterns, forecast high-demand locations, and even discover maintenance needs automatically.

More Secure Streets Through Real-Time Intelligence
AI is not practically rate and efficiency-- it's likewise concerning safety. From determining speeding lorries in real time to predicting accident-prone zones, AI is assisting make roads more secure for everyone.
Smart monitoring systems powered by artificial intelligence can detect harmful actions, such as illegal turns, running red lights, or jaywalking. These systems don't just function as deterrents; they produce information that cities can make use of to educate future safety initiatives.
AI is also helping very first responders reach emergencies quicker. Real-time web traffic analysis can direct ambulances along the quickest path, even during rush hour. And when secs matter, those time financial savings can be life-altering.
